Market Snapshot: Self-Healing Materials Market Growth
The Self-healing Materials Market grew from USD 2.99 billion in 2024 to USD 3.66 billion in 2025. Propelled by a compound annual growth rate (CAGR) of 23.21%, it is expected to reach USD 15.90 billion by 2032. This rapid expansion reflects rising adoption across advanced manufacturing, automotive, aerospace, and electronics sectors. Significant progress in nanotechnology and smart chemistry underpins this growth, while regulatory and supply chain shifts continue to influence market evolution worldwide.
Scope & Segmentation
- Material Types: Ceramic materials (including non-oxide and oxide), coatings, composites (fiber reinforced, hybrid, nano), metallics (amorphous metals, smart alloys), and polymerics (elastomers, thermoplastic polymers).
- Form Factors: Bulk materials, composites and plastics, fibers, films and coatings, foams, and powders.
- Healing Mechanisms: Capsule-based healing, extrinsic self-healing, intrinsic self-healing, vascular healing.
- End-Use Industries: Aerospace (engine parts, structural components), automotive (exterior, interior components), construction, electronics (circuit boards, displays), medical (implants, wearable devices such as fitness trackers and health monitors).

Tariff Impact: Adjustments Shaping Supply Chains
Recent United States tariff adjustments in 2025 have introduced unpredictability into global supply chains by raising costs for key raw materials such as specialty polymers, smart alloys, and advanced coatings. In response, manufacturers are reassessing sourcing, investing in recycling, and shifting to more localized production to mitigate exposure. Strategic supplier partnerships and diversification of feedstocks are enabling companies to sustain output and maintain performance standards despite evolving trade dynamics.
